6. Förskolans formande : Statlig reglering 1944–2008
Sammanfattning : Preschool is a central part of Swedish family life. The manner in which the state regulates preschool through laws, ordinances, and various kinds of written objectives has an impact on many people in the Swedish society. The thesis examines the development of preschool state regulation from the 1940s until 2008. LÄS MER

9. Det kontrollera(n)de klassrummet : bedömningsprocessen i svensk grundskolepraktik i relation till införandet av nationella skolreformer
Sammanfattning : The aim of this thesis is to investigate the assessment process in Swedish compulsory school practice, and the changes that occur in relation to the introduction of national school reforms. The fieldwork forming the basis of the thesis was conducted in year five and year six classrooms between 2011-2013, a period during which new national syllabuses with knowledge requirements, grades in year six and extended national tests were introduced. 10. Kan man räkna med PISA och TIMSS? : Relevansen hos internationella storskaliga mätningar i matematik i en nationell kontext
Sammanfattning : The overall purpose of the thesis is to contribute to the knowledge of relevance of international large-scale assessments (ILSAs) in mathematics, when these are to be used and interpreted in a national context. If a nation is to engage in ILSAs, draw conclusions from them and act on them, one should be aware of what they are measuring and how well it fits in with the national mathematics education and the mathematics they are trying to teach their students.
